Apr 24, 2018 The main objective of the soil stabilization is to increase the bearing capacity of the soil and maximum dry density. This paper assesses the stabilizing effect of crusher dust on the soil. Crusher dust is added to the soil at varying proportions like 20%, 30% and 40% by the weight of the soil sample throughout.
This paper deals with the stabilization of soil using crusher dust. Crusher dust is a common by product of quarrying and mining. Crusher dust have excellent load bearing capability and durability. It is also non plastic. The objectives of this study are to determine if crusher dust can stabilize the soil

One way that both Road Base and Crusher Dust can be made more durable is with the addition of cement. This is referred to as stabalising and is common practice in areas of high traffic or potential erosion. How much cement is added is up to the individual but generally around 4-8 bags per Tonne of product is the preferred mix ratio.

There is a decrease in OMC and increase in MDD with the increase of crusher dust in lime stabilized BC soil. It is observed that when lime stabilized clay sample is mixed with 20% crusher dust the MDD increased from 1.58 g/cc to 1.81 g/cc with decrease in OMC from 22% to 14.3%.
Mar 21, 2019 The rock particles should range in size from dust to 3/8 inch. Gravel and crusher fines differ from one another in that gravel is screened to remove the fines which contain the natural binders/cements. Crusher fines applied over landscape fabric to a depth of 4-6 inches.
Crusher fines are small particles of crushed rock. Generally, they are the leftovers from rock crushing operations, but at times the rock can be ground especially to make the crusher fines. To make a good trail surfacing material, they should have a range of particle sizes from a
Oct 02, 2011 Compacted crusher dust or roadbase is perfectly adequate for a perimeter path and if you mix cement in with it (14x20kg bags per cubic metre of roadbase/crusher dust makes a pretty good concrete) and thoroughly compact it, it will draw in ground moisture and set hard anyway.
When surfaces such as asphalt and concrete retain heat in an urban environment it is called the Heat Island Effect. Lighter colored Stabilized Decomposed Granite and Crushed Stone aggregates can reflect solar rays reducing the heat retained in the pathway surface. This is measured by the Solar Reflectance Index.
